No later than July 31st of each year, the Tourism Administration shall provide to the County Commissioners Court and City Council a proposed written annual Budget for the use of all HOT Funds. The budget shall outline the portion of HOT Funds received from the City’s collections and their allocated expenditures and shall outline the portion of HOT Funds received from the County’s collections and their allocated expenditures. The County and City shall, in writing, approve in advance the annual budget of theTourism Department. Furthermore, County shall at least monthly (first Monday ofthe month) provide a list of expenditures of the Tourism Department with HOT Funds.

Reporting and Auditing. 6.5.1 The Publisher must maintain records and report to the Contributor at least quarterly, any sales or syndications in relation to the Work, in sufficient detail to enable the Contributor to verify amounts payable under this agreement.
Reporting and Auditing a. CEL will provide a written statement to Publisher on a calendar semi-annual basis, specifying which portion of each payment to Publisher is attributable to which Title. The statement will accompany the payment, if any, due to the Publisher pursuant to Exhibit C, but CEL will provide a statement for each calendar period, regardless of whether any payment is due.

VENDOR must maintain a record of all customers and trips, and submit a copy of the records to FACT monthly, unless a particular program requires more frequent data transmittal in which case the program requirements will prevail and be binding on VENDOR. This record will include the rider information, pick-up and drop-off locations and times, mileage, revenue hours 1, service hours2, status of each trip, and fare.
